The Power of Online Reviews

Online reviews serve as a form of social proof, demonstrating to potential customers that your business is reputable and trustworthy. Positive reviews can encourage visitors to explore your website and make a purchase, while negative reviews can deter them.

The Role of Google My Business Reviews

Google My Business is a powerful platform for managing your local business presence. It allows you to create a business profile, add photos, and collect customer reviews. Google My Business reviews can significantly impact your local search rankings and visibility.

  1. Claim and optimize your Google My Business profile.
  2. Encourage customers to leave reviews on your Google My Business listing.
  3. Respond to reviews promptly to demonstrate your commitment to customer satisfaction.

How can online reviews help improve SEO?

Online reviews can positively impact your SEO in several ways:

  • Increased visibility: Positive reviews can boost your local search rankings on platforms like Google My Business.
  • Improved click-through rates: Search engines may prioritize websites with positive reviews in search results, leading to higher click-through rates.
  • Backlinks: Customers may link to your website from their review profiles, providing valuable backlinks that can improve your search engine rankings.
  • Keyword optimization: Reviews often contain relevant keywords related to your business, which can help your website rank higher for those terms.

Which platforms should I prioritize for collecting online reviews?

The best platforms for collecting online reviews depend on your industry and target audience. Here are some popular options:

  • Google My Business: Essential for local businesses, as it directly impacts your local search rankings.
  • Yelp: A popular review platform for businesses in various industries.
  • TripAdvisor: Ideal for restaurants, hotels, and other travel-related businesses.
  • Industry-specific review sites: Websites like G2 Crowd (software) or Angie’s List (home services) can be valuable for specific industries.
